IP查询
查询
你查询的IP:[121.4.79.87] 地理位置:中国–上海–上海
最新查询
116.76.122.171
125.64.18.121
222.32.176.216
203.86.18.187
119.78.65.187
118.80.143.150
203.223.5.105
58.240.65.176
203.90.239.219
121.4.79.87
202.127.112.254
60.255.143.168
125.169.190.28
61.236.78.140
114.54.119.214
119.176.158.184
202.131.16.212
117.40.115.137
221.198.133.68
118.248.210.38
210.28.19.156
220.248.172.51
221.133.224.219
202.90.122.38
202.92.252.104
121.201.58.14
122.224.57.217
116.242.93.1
219.128.95.139
122.4.140.161
117.60.200.205